Vakili Raises The River

Level 3 : 200/300, 300 ante
Reza Vakili
Reza Vakili

The player under the gun limped into the pot and was called by the player in the small blind. Reza Vakili then raised to 1,300 from the big blind. Both opponents called.

The flop came {k-Diamonds}{5-Spades}{j-Spades} and the small blind checked. Vakili continued for 1,400. The player under the gun folded. The small blind called.

The turn brought the {7-Hearts} and the small blind led out for 1,500. Vakili called.

The {k-Hearts} completed the board and the small blind tossed out 2,500. Vakili immediately raised to 6,500. His opponent snap-mucked his hand.

Pritchard Flushes Benson

Level 3 : 200/300, 300 ante

Australia Poker Hall of Famer Garry Benson is in the field and was caught in action in a hand against Jason Pritchard.

With the community cards spread {6-Diamonds}{4-Diamonds}{3-Diamonds}{6-Clubs}{q-Diamonds} and over 8,000 in the pot, Pritchard showed down {a-Diamonds}{10-Diamonds} to claim the pot. Pritchard climbed to 32,000 after the hand, and while Benson is above starting stack, he dropped down to 35,000.

Mitri Back to Starting Stack

Level 3 : 200/300, 300 ante
George Mitri
George Mitri

George Mitri raised to 900 from under the gun before the player in middle position re-raised to 3,000. Mitri called.

The flop came {a-Diamonds}{4-Hearts}{6-Hearts} and Mitri checked. The original raiser continued for 2,000. Mitri called.

Both players then checked down the {q-Diamonds} turn followed by the {9-Clubs} river.

Mitri tabled {a-Spades}{8-Spades} for top pair, and took down the pot, after his opponent mucked his hand.

Zreika Folds Out Antar

Level 3 : 200/300, 300 ante

Yu Chen opened the action from the hijack with a raise to 600 following an under-the-gun limp from Gazi Zreika, with Richie Samia making the call from one seat over before small blind Joe Antar squeezed to 3,000.

Zreika was the only caller to take the pair to a flop of {3-Diamonds}{7-Clubs}{10-Hearts} which saw Antar continuation bet 2,000, with Zreika making the call once more to bring in the {2-Diamonds} turn.

That was as far as the hand got, with Antar check-folding to Zreika's 2,600 turn bet to drop down to 11,100, while Zreika stacked up to 45,000.

Zheng Riding Rollercoaster

Level 3 : 200/300, 300 ante

Lionel Zheng is riding a rollercoaster these first few levels having had aces cracked already. Things did not improve for the Singaporean in a hand against Lirui Zhang with the two contesting a hand that saw Zhang win the pot with {a-Clubs}{3-Hearts} on a {5-Hearts}{4-Diamonds}{2-Hearts}{a-Spades}{x-} board, beating Zheng (big blinds) {5-Diamonds}{6-Spades} to claim the pot.

Zheng dropped to 33,000 while Zhang climbed to 48,000.

Caridad Chips Up Early

Level 2 : 100/200, 200 ante

The player under the gun plus one limped into the pot before Dejan Boskovic raised to 1,000 from middle position. John Caridad called from the hijack. The player in the big blind called as well as the original limper to see four players go to the flop.

The dealer produced {3-Hearts}{5-Clubs}{10-Diamonds} and the action checked to Boskovic who continued for 1,600. Caridad and the player under the gun called.

The three players then checked down the {4-Clubs} on the turn as well as the {3-Diamonds} on the river.

The player under the gun tabled his {a-Diamonds}{j-Diamonds} first prompting a fold from Boskovic. Caridad then talbled his {7-Spades}{4-Spades} for a pair and took down the pot.

Zenonos Wins Multiway

Level 2 : 100/200, 200 ante

There was some multiway action with a player in early position, Christopher Zenonos in middle position, hijack Christopher Simms and cutoff Matthew Howearth all contesting the 2,000-chip pot.

The flop was out and was spread {10-Clubs}{9-Spades}{6-Spades} with Zenonos leading out for 900 and picking up callers in the form of both Simms and Howearth.

The turn came down the {9-Hearts} to pair the board and Zenonos loaded up another barrel and blasted out a bet of 1,500. That deterred neither of the two callers with both Simms and Howearth making the call.

The {j-Clubs} river completed the hand, but not the betting with Zenonos firing a 3,000 third barrel. Simms was the only caller.

Zenonos rolled over {10-Diamonds}{9-Diamonds} for a full house and Simms mucked without showing down, though he did mention in table chat that it was the first time he had lost with a full house, claiming pocket sixes. If so Simms did well to hold onto the 4,200 in chips he had left, while Zenonos stacked up to 40,000. Howearth has 24,000.

Abdine Shoves on the River

Level 2 : 100/200, 200 ante
Shivan Abdine
Shivan Abdine

Gazi Zreika limped from under the gun and was followed by Maranic Ljudevit in the cutoff. Sivan Abdine then raised to 1,100 from the button. Paul Issa called from the big blind. Zreika and Ljudevit came along.

The flop came {10-Diamonds}{q-Clubs}{4-Diamonds} and Issa immediately tossed out 1,300. Zreika snap-called. Ljudevit got out of the way. Abdine called.

The turn brought the {6-Spades} and Issa threw out another 1,300. Zreika instantly raised to 4,400. Abdine called. Issa also obliged.

The {k-Spades} completed the board and Issa checked. Zreika reached for his chips and bet 7,000. Abdine paused for a minute then moved all in for 15,600. Issa snap-folded. Zreika didn’t seem pleased with the shove opting to muck his hand shortly after.

A Full House

Level 2 : 100/200, 200 ante
The Star Sydney Poker Room
The Star Sydney Poker Room

It's a full house, with 351 players sitting on The Star Sydney's tournament tables, with 39 tables in operation.

There is a sizable alternates list waiting to get in on the action and there have been a couple of early eliminations to bring the total number of Day 1d entries up to 355.

There is still a sizable list waiting on the sidelines eager to join the fray, so it looks like it's going to be a busy day.
